您当前位置: 主页 > 热门软件
fliqlo

fliqlo

  • 分类:

    热门软件

    大小:

    6.04MB

    提现:

    0元起

  • 支持:

    Android

    浏览:

    下载:

    5682次

  • 评分:

    开发者:

  • 版本号:

    1.4.2

    更新:

    2025-02-18 08:09

fliqlo

试玩介绍

你知道吗?在这个信息爆炸的时代,软件安全可是个头等大事!尤其是那些涉及我们个人隐私和重要数据的软件,安全性更是重中之重。今天,我就要和你聊聊一个特别重要的环节——软件安全SQL测试。别小看这个测试,它可是保护我们信息安全的大功臣呢!

一、揭秘SQL测试:守护信息安全的小卫士

SQL测试,顾名思义,就是针对软件中使用的SQL(结构化查询语言)进行的一系列测试。简单来说,就是检查软件在处理数据库查询时是否存在安全漏洞。为什么这么说呢?因为SQL注入攻击可是个让人头疼的家伙,一旦中了招,后果不堪设想。

想象如果你在网上购物时,输入的个人信息被黑客窃取,那可就糟了。而这一切,都可能是由于软件中的SQL漏洞导致的。所以,进行SQL测试,就是为了确保我们的信息安全。

二、SQL测试的“三剑客”:代码审查、渗透测试、数据扫描

那么,如何进行SQL测试呢?其实,主要有三种方法:代码审查、渗透测试和数据扫描。

1. 代码审查:就像医生给病人做体检一样,代码审查就是通过人工或工具对软件代码进行审查,找出潜在的安全漏洞。这个过程就像是在软件的“DNA”中寻找异常,确保每一行代码都符合安全规范。

2. 渗透测试:这个测试就像是一场“黑客大战”,测试人员会模拟黑客攻击,试图找出软件中的安全漏洞。如果测试人员能够成功入侵系统,那就说明软件存在安全风险。

3. 数据扫描:这个测试就像是在软件的“血液”中寻找病毒,通过扫描软件中的数据,找出可能存在的安全风险。比如,检查数据是否被加密、是否被篡改等。

三、SQL测试的“五项修炼”:全面性、保密性、可靠性、客观性、实用性

进行SQL测试,可不是一件简单的事情。它需要遵循以下五个原则:

1. 全面性:就像医生给病人做全面检查一样,SQL测试也要全面覆盖软件的各个方面,确保没有遗漏。

2. 保密性:测试过程中,可能会涉及到一些敏感信息,所以必须采取严格的保密措施,确保信息安全。

3. 可靠性:测试结果必须准确可靠,不能有误判。

4. 客观性:测试结果和分析必须基于客观的数据和事实,不能受主观因素的影响。

5. 实用性:测试结果要能够指导开发人员进行修复,提高软件的安全性。

四、SQL测试的“实战演练”:以Burpsuite为例

那么,如何使用工具进行SQL测试呢?以Burpsuite为例,这款强大的Web安全测试工具可以帮助我们轻松进行SQL测试。

1. 环境配置:首先,需要正确配置Burpsuite和浏览器的代理设置。这样,所有通过浏览器的HTTP请求都将被Burpsuite捕获,从而进行分析和修改。

2. POST方式的SQL注入:通过Burpsuite的Repeater功能,我们可以修改POST请求的数据,测试SQL注入漏洞。比如,在用户名和密码字段中添加SQL语句,查看服务器是否对输入进行了适当的过滤。

3. 盲注技术:布尔盲注和时间盲注是两种常见的盲注技术。布尔盲注通过页面的不同响应来判断条件是否满足,而时间盲注则通过页面的响应时间来判断。

4. HTTP头注入:除了POST数据,HTTP请求头也可能成为SQL注入的攻击点。例如,User-Agent和Referer字段中的数据可能被服务器记录并用于构建SQL查询。

五、:SQL测试,守护信息安全的重要防线

SQL测试是保护信息安全的重要防线。通过代码审查、渗透测试和数据扫描等方法,我们可以找出软件中的安全漏洞,确保我们的信息安全。所以,在进行软件开发和测试时,一定要重视SQL测试,让我们的信息安全得到保障!

fliqlo

赚钱截图
手赚资讯